The Quality Programs Manager will lead up major global quality project initiatives that drive our Quality team to seamless processes and consistency of practices across our global locations. Delivery of these initiatives is core to the Quality Strategy. Projects will include opportunities identified through the internal audit process, proactive quality gap analysis and customer experience enhancement.
As the Quality Programs Manager, you will impact every element of the companies Quality Program. Working directly with the Group Quality Director, your keen ability to effectively lead projects to successful implementation and to identify continuous improvement opportunities within our existing processes is critical. The right person for this role is willing to challenge the paradigms that exist within the Quality organization.
A successful candidate must demonstrate advanced project management knowledge across the full project lifecycle and strong collaboration skills to drive adoption across our various global locations.
You will be responsible for:
* Leading large quality workstreams, initiatives and projects that typically have organization-wide impact
* Working closely across workstream teams (QA managers/leads, technical leads, 3rd party vendors, etc.) to ensure cross dependencies and potential conflicts are documented and communicated.
* Planning for the next phase of the program as it finishes development and enters testing & implementation
* Tracking and monitoring improvement project status and effectiveness
* Keeping resources accountable
* Facilitating meetings with cross functional teams and executives
* Presenting status reports to senior level audiences
* Providing a voice for Quality in global business meetings
* Assisting with the selection, onboarding and successful transition of new hires.
* Working with cross functional partners on projects that impact Quality
* Championing quality improvement efforts and problem-solving efforts
* Assisting with monitoring Quality performance against budget and leading programs to reduce spending on reactive quality measures, repurposing that spending for proactive quality measures.
Technical Requirements
* Project Management experience
* QA experience
* Experience in leading continuous improvement activities/projects
* Knowledge of lean, six sigma tools, TQM methodology, etc.
* Technical background (Engineering, Sourcing, Supply Chain)
* Expert with MS Excel, Project, and PowerPoint
* Excellent inter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ills with the ability to interface with people at all levels of the organization
* Ability to work independently, with strong organizational and flexibility skills in a team-oriented environment
* Financial management skills, such as budgeting
